Skip to main content

2016 | Buch

Web Service Composition

insite
SUCHEN

Über dieses Buch

This book carefully defines the technologies involved in web service composition and provides a formal basis for all of the composition approaches and shows the trade-offs among them. By considering web services as a deep formal topic, some surprising results emerge, such as the possibility of eliminating workflows. It examines the immense potential of web services composition for revolutionizing business IT as evidenced by the marketing of Service Oriented Architectures (SOAs).
The author begins with informal considerations and builds to the formalisms slowly, with easily-understood motivating examples. Chapters examine the importance of semantics for web services and ways to apply semantic technologies. Topics included range from model checking and Golog to WSDL and AI planning. This book is based upon lectures given to economics students and is suitable for business technologist with some computer science background. The reader can delve as deeply into the technologies as desired.

Inhaltsverzeichnis

Frontmatter
Chapter 1. Basic Definitions
Abstract
The fundamental definitions of web services are defined in this chapter, providing the basis for understanding the issues and benefits of composing web services.
Charles J. Petrie
Chapter 2. REST-Based Services
Abstract
WSDL-based web services have not been successful in industry. An alternative are REST-based web services, with some modification.
Charles J. Petrie
Chapter 3. Formalization of Web Service Composition
Abstract
This chapter provides the formal foundations for web service composition.
Charles J. Petrie
Chapter 4. Methods of Web Service Composition
Abstract
This chapter explains methods of web service composition using the formalism of the previous chapter.
Charles J. Petrie
Metadaten
Titel
Web Service Composition
verfasst von
Charles J. Petrie
Copyright-Jahr
2016
Electronic ISBN
978-3-319-32833-1
Print ISBN
978-3-319-32831-7
DOI
https://doi.org/10.1007/978-3-319-32833-1

Premium Partner